The Calathea Ornata Sanderiana is recognizable by its striking leaves. The dark green leaves are large and oval-shaped. What stands out are the pink stripes on the leaves. The underside of the leaf is purple. Another unique feature is that the leaves close in the evening and open again in the morning. The Calathea is an air purifier, so it takes good care of you! The plant absorbs harmful substances from the air and converts them into oxygen.

Fun to know "Calathea is known for its ""living"" leaves that move upward at night and fold down during the day, a phenomenon known as nyctinasty. This movement is so distinctive that it has earned the plant the nickname ""Prayer Plant."""

Light

Prefers bright, indirect light but can be harmed by direct sunlight.

Water

Keep the soil consistently moist but avoid waterlogged conditions.

Nutrition

Fertilize every month during the growing season with a diluted, balanced liquid fertilizer.
